Vulnerability Description
SurrealDB versions before 3.1.0 contain an information disclosure vulnerability where authenticated users with UPDATE access can read field values hidden by field-level SELECT permissions through error messages. Attackers can trigger arithmetic or extend operations on hidden fields to embed raw operand values in error responses, bypassing field-level access controls.

Affected Products
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Surrealdb | Surrealdb | < 3.1.0 |
